Figure 8 Sinomenine-induced pluripotent stem cells-immature dendritic cells immunization suppressed T cells and increased activated regulatory T cells in allografts. A: Sinomenine (SN)-induced pluripotent stem cells (iPSCs)-immature dendritic cells (imDCs) increased the ratio of CD4+CD25+ regulatory T (Treg) cells/CD4+ T cells in spleen. Compared with PBS group, aP < 0.05. Compared with iPSCs-imDCs group, bP < 0.05. Compared with SN group, cP < 0.05; B: SN-iPSCs-imDCs increased the ratio of CD4+CD25+FoxP3+ Treg cells/CD4+CD25+ Treg cells in spleen. Compared with iPSCs-imDCs group, bP < 0.05. Compared with SN group, cP < 0.05; C: Reactivity of recipient lymphocytes to donor or unrelated third-party lymphocytes. Compared to third-party lymphocytes, aP < 0.05. Compared with iPSCs-imDCs group, bP < 0.05; D: SN-iPSCs-imDCs downregulated proinflammatory cytokines and upregulated anti-inflammatory cytokines. Compared with PBS group, aP < 0.05. Compared with iPSCs-imDCs group, bP < 0.05. SN: Sinomenine; iPSCs: Induced pluripotent stem cells; DCs: Dendritic cells; imDCs: Immature dendritic cells; IL: Interleukin; IFN: Interferon; TGF-: Transforming growth factor-.
